Thousands of mourners yesterday attended the State funeral service of former President Tassos Papasopoulos, The former president died on Friday, aged 74. Archbishop Chrysostomos presided over the service at the new Saint Sophia church in the Nicosia suburb of Strovolos. Papadopoulos served as president from 2003 capping a fifty-year long career in politics until the presidential election in March this year, when he was defeated by the now President Demetris Christofias. Greek Prime Minister Costas Karamanlis and Foreign Minister Dora Bakoyianni were among politicians, friends and admirers who paid their last respects to Papadopoulos. Thousands also gathered at the Deftera cemetery to pay their respects with a national guard attachment firing three shots in the air in salute.
